Would it be possible to change your automatic transmission fluid this way?

1. Disconnect the line at the transmission cooler.
2. Attach a hose to the return line and the other end to a 5 gallon container of fresh fluid.
3. Let the other opening drain into an oil pan.
4. Start the car and allow the fresh fluid to flow from the 5 gallon container through the system and old fluid will be pumped into the drain pan. Shut off the vehichle when the 5 gallon container is close to empty.
5. Reconnect the hose to the transmission cooler.
6. Check the fluid level and top off if needed.

Do you think this would work?
 
The ATF pickup is in the pan(sump). The return hose will not have any suction. So, it won't work.
 
Hmm ..probably ..but not at the rate that it will be pumping out at. This came up before from another poster. You're trying to get a seamless exchange.

The only way that I think this would work would be IF you could get two sealed containers that you could attach the lines to. An empty one would receive the outgoing fluid. This would pressurize the sealed bucket. A line from that bucket would then transfer the displaced air into the full bucket of new fluid. That air pressure would push the new fluid into the transmission. I imagine elevating the buckets would aid in the flow after the siphoning effect is established.

This is how some fluid exchange systems work ..except that they have a piston separating the new and old fluid. As the old fluid is purged ..it forces the piston ..which pushes the new fluid in.

No, don't give up. If you're willing to do what you originally planned, it's just as easy another way.

Here's the fluid change method I use on all my cars that don't have a torque converter drain plug:

1. Pull the transmission dipstick (located near the firewall in most cars). Fresh fluid is translucent and cherry red. Some darkening is normal, but if it is reddish brown or mustard color and smells like burnt varnish, it is worn out.

2. Make sure the fluid is warm.

3. Remove all pan bolts except for the corners. Remove the bolt from the lowest corner, then loosen the other corner bolts a turn or two. Carefully pry the pan to break the gasket seal at the lowest corner. Drain mostly from this corner. With good technique you can avoid or at least minimize the red bath.

4. Remove pan. Inspect the pan before cleaning. A small amount of fine grey clutch dust is normal. However, if you find metal shavings, there has been transmission damage. Remove all old gasket material. Clean the pan and magnet with solvent and wipe dry so there is no harmful residue. Shop air can be used to clean the magnet. Hammer back any pan damage from previous overtightening.

5. (Optional) Drill hole in pan at low point and install a drain kit available from most auto supply houses. Make sure the kit protruding inside the pan doesn't interfere with anything on the transmission.

6. Replace filter.

7. Position gasket on pan. Some gaskets have four holes slightly smaller than the rest to allow four bolts through the pan and through these smaller holes to hold the four bolts and gasket in place.

8. Hand tighten pan bolts in a criss-cross pattern. After that, use a torque wrench to tighten bolts to proper ft-lbs as per manufacturer.

9. Refill the transmission using only the amount shown as “refill capacity” in the owners manual (or an equal amount that was drained), using the type of fluid specified for the vehicle.

10. You now have replaced the transmission fluid and filter according to manufacturer’s requirements. Fluid is changed in the pan only.

You can stop here and go to Step 17 if you just wanted a regular drop-the-pan fluid change. For a complete exchange of the fluid (including transmission body and torquer converter) continue with the next steps.

11. Obtain the total system capacity of the vehicle from the manufacturer. Have this amount - plus a bit more - of fluid readily available.

12. Disconnect the oil cooler line from the oil cooler. Tickle the ignition to find the flow direction. Direct the stream of fluid toward a receptacle. It is better to use a clear length of hose with a shoplight laying next to it so you can see when all the old fluid has left the system.

13. Start the engine, let it idle to pump out old transmission fluid until you start seeing air bubbles.

14. Stop the engine. Refill transmission through fill tube with fresh fluid - same amount as pumped out (usually about 2-3 quarts).

15. When either the fluid color brightens or the total capacity has been replaced, shut the engine off and re-attach the oil cooler line. All transmission fluid has now been changed.

16. Button everything back up. Clean up the mess.

17. Recheck the fluid level. With the car on level ground, set the parking brake and the transmission in “Park” or “Neutral.” Let the engine idle for a few minutes. Shift the transmission through all detents, pausing momentarily at each position, before returning the lever to “Park” or “Neutral.” Check the fluid level again and check for leaks. Refill fluid so it is slightly undercharged. This way it can be properly checked and topped off after a long drive.
 
Here's a simple method to make a extractor.

I had a clear/translucent bucket. It has a top that snaps on (also has a handle). I drilled a hole on the top and attached a 1.5'' PVC pipe fitting, on the opposite side of the top I drilled a small hole and attached 2 1/4'' barbed fitting with a connector, so that one is on the top and the other on the bottom. I also bought 10' of clear 1/4'' hose and cut a small piece to that the bottom barbed fitting to the bottom of the pail. Put the lid on and connect the top barbed in to what you want to suck/pump out. Insert your shop vacuum in the 1.5'' PVC connector and the fluid will be sucked through the hose and into the pail.

Total cost about $6. The shop vac never ingests anything since it's separted.
